How many people are in the world? 6 Billion
How many are Christian? 1.9 Billion

Since 1900 the number of Christians in the world has quadrupled, from 555 million (32.2 percent), in 1900 to 1.9 billion in 2000 (31 percent).

Christianity is the largest religion in the world. Close to 1/3 of all the people on the planet, profess to be Christians.
Just to place this in perspective: Islam had 200 million in 1900 (12.3 percent) and 1.2 Billion (19.6 ) now. Today Hinduism 811 million, Buddhism 60 million, Sikhism 23 million, and Judaism 14 million (World christian Encyclopedia 2001).

Now, how many of these “Christians” do you think are Roman Catholic?
1 BILLION 30 MILLION.
The Roman Catholic church is the largest body of Christians on earth. More than one out of every six people on the planet is Roman Catholic.
TODAY THERE ARE 480 MILLION PROTESTANTS
